Events

John of Ephesus found Thomas and Zota years later in the desert of Mendis by Mar Menas. Thomas's body was frail and sunburnt. He had dedicated his life to fasting, praying, so that by depriving the body he would purify the soul. See factoid page


the monk who stole was ashamed, and left everything he stole, and went to the desert of Mendia, to the convent of Andrew , near the monastery of holy Mar Menas . See factoid page


Susan heard of a place beyond the House of Mars Menas and directed her steps there. See factoid page


A tower was erected in Mars Menas for protection, in which the women who followed Susan dwelt and made a living from the labor of their hands. See factoid page


Residence:

Susan resided near the House of Mars Menas. See factoid page

Anonymi 3662 resided near the House of Mars Menas. See factoid page
